Explainer How Does Cloud Seeding Work What is cloud seeding? cloud seeding aims at producing rain or snow by introducing particles into clouds that act as condensation nuclei and promote precipitation. the practice dates back to the 1940s. goals of cloud seeding are improving water supplies and crop yields and preventing hail and storm damage to sensitive regions. Cloud seeding is a type of weather modification that aims to change the amount or type of precipitation, mitigate hail, or disperse fog. the usual objective is to increase rain or snow, either for its own sake or to prevent precipitation from occurring in days afterward.

At its core, cloud seeding represents a deliberate effort to influence precipitation patterns within clouds, a practice dating back to the mid 20th century. scientists aim to modify atmospheric conditions subtly, encouraging existing clouds to release more of their stored moisture. Cloud seeding, deliberate introduction into clouds of various substances that act as condensation nuclei or ice nuclei in an attempt to induce precipitation. this serves to increase water supplies and mountain snow packs and can suppress the formation of large hailstones (see also hail). Cloud seeding works by introducing substances into the atmosphere that encourage the formation of precipitation. these substances, known as seeding agents, can be dispersed into clouds to stimulate the growth of water droplets or ice crystals, which then fall to the ground as rain or snow.

Cloud seeding doesn’t create weather from nothing. it works by introducing particles into clouds that already contain moisture, encouraging that moisture to form into rain or snow faster than it would on its own. Cloud seeding is a weather modification technique that disperses substances like silver iodide into clouds to enhance precipitation. its effectiveness varies and remains debated. cloud seeding is used for increasing rainfall, combating drought, and boosting hydroelectric power. Understanding the basics: cloud seeding is a method used to alter weather patterns by inducing or enhancing precipitation within clouds. seeding agents, such as silver iodide or potassium iodide, are dispersed into clouds, where they act as nuclei around which water droplets or ice crystals form.
